File path: airflow/executors/celery_executor.py
##########
@@ -341,11 +341,13 @@ def _check_for_stalled_adopted_tasks(self):
         just resend them. We do that by clearing the state and letting the
         normal scheduler loop deal with that
         """
-        now = utcnow()
+        sorted_adopted_task_timeouts = OrderedDict(
+            sorted(self.adopted_task_timeouts.items(), key=lambda k: k[1])
+        )

Review comment:
       Probably don’t even need `OrderedDict` since all we do is calling 
`items()` later anyway.
   
   This should be good enough:
   
   ```
   sorted_adopted_task_timeouts = sorted(self.adopted_task_timeouts.items(), 
key=lambda k: k[1])
   
   for key, stalled_after in sorted_adopted_task_timeouts:
       ...
   ```
   
   Also I feel having `utcnow()` outside of the loop is slightly better? It 
saves some function calls, unless millisecond accuracy is actually important 
here. But that’s minor either way.
